Climate overview of Santa Cruz do Sul

Santa Cruz do Sul, Rio Grande do Sul, Brazil, experiences significant temperature variation throughout the year. Summers bring daytime highs of 31°C (88°F) in January, while winters cool to 20°C (68°F) in July.

With around 1836 mm (72 in) of annual rainfall, Santa Cruz do Sul has a notably wet climate. The wettest month is October.

Monthly Temperature in Santa Cruz do Sul

Depending on the time of the year, temperatures range from very warm to pleasant in Santa Cruz do Sul. Average daytime temperatures reach a very warm 31°C (88°F) in January. In July, the coolest month of the year, temperatures drop to a pleasant 20°C (68°F).

At night, temperatures range from around 19°C (66°F) in January to 9°C (48°F) in July.

Rainfall in Santa Cruz do Sul

Santa Cruz do Sul has a relatively rainy climate with high precipitation levels, averaging 1836 mm (72 in) of rainfall annually. Despite minor fluctuations, Santa Cruz do Sul enjoys fairly consistent precipitation throughout the year. In October, you can expect around 206 mm (8.1 in) of precipitation, while in May, Santa Cruz do Sul receives about 127 mm (5 in). Best Time to Visit Santa Cruz do Sul

During the months of March, April, May, June, August and November, Santa Cruz do Sul enjoys pleasant weather with average temperatures ranging from 20°C (69°F) to 29°C (85°F). These months are perfect for sightseeing and exploring.

Rainfall during this time ranges from 127 mm (5 in) in May to 143 mm (5.6 in) in November. This means you can expect a mix of sunny days and occasional showers.

The rainy season falls during January, February, September, October and December, bringing heavy precipitation.
